What energy is stored in a cell?
ATP or adenosine triphosphate is chemical energy the cell can use. It is the molecule that provides energy for your cells to perform work. Energy is stored when an ATP molecule is formed. Energy is released when an ATP molecule is broken down.

Which term refers to stored energy due to the position of an object?
An object can store energy as the result of its position. … This stored energy of position is referred to as potential energy. Potential energy is the stored energy of position possessed by an object.

How is energy stored in the body?
Energy is actually stored in your liver and muscle cells and readily available as glycogen. We know this as carbohydrate energy. When carbohydrate energy is needed glycogen is converted into glucose for use by the muscle cells. Another source of fuel for the body is protein but is rarely a significant source of fuel.

Is potential energy stored?
Potential energy is technically stored within matter though a force must be applied to an object in order for it to store potential energy. However while the energy itself is stored in the mass of the object another force (gravitational or elastic) must be present to release the potential energy.

What is meaning of chemical energy?
chemical energy Energy stored in the bonds of chemical compounds. Chemical energy may be released during a chemical reaction often in the form of heat such reactions are called exothermic. … The chemical energy in food is converted by the body into mechanical energy and heat.
